Ofsted rating for Cam Nursery is Outstanding (November 2022)

Co-op Childcare Cam have a sensory garden filled with scented plants like lavender and mint, so their children learn about lots of different smells and textures through teacher-led activities or exploring on their own.

They are big on happy children, they have areas for growing food, regular visits to local care homes and focus on taking care of each other and the world. They are silver eco schools accredited, a programme that sees children lead the way in making little changes that have big environmental differences.

They have 5 Little Pioneers who help share their core values to children, from encouraging them to make their own decisions to expressing their feelings. They have an app for parents/carers, ParentZone, which keeps them updated on how their little ones are getting on at nursery, from photos of their day, meals eaten and even toilet training progress!

They are also big on safety which is why all their staff are paediatric first aid trained!

There are 4 home rooms within the nursery split into the following age groups: 0-2 year olds, 2-3 year olds, 3-5 year olds. The nursery has a car park to the front of the building for easy access. There is a garden to rear and side of the building. The garden includes a nature area, a growing area, 2 soft play areas and a dedicated baby garden.
